With that commitment in mind, our union created the SEIU Local 503 Educational Scholarship program, which allows members and their families to apply for scholarships to help them continue in their education.
This year, twenty union members and their families were selected to receive scholarship support for college, helping them to grow in their careers and avoid the debt that often comes with higher education.
“I am so grateful for this award and thankful for the chance to further my education,” says Kayleana Green, who is the daughter of union member William Matthews and will be attending Oregon State University in the fall to study biochemistry. “This award will allow me to focus on school more, rather than work, without putting myself into debt.”
The scholarship amounts to $1,500 per recipient and is available to people who are working in a represented bargaining unit, their family and dependents, and even the surviving dependents of a recently deceased member.
